Running on a soggy, windy afternoon Friday in Notre Dame, Ind., the Valparaiso men’s cross country team placed 18th in the Gold division of the Notre Dame Invitational.

Valpo registered 555 points on Friday afternoon for its 18th place showing and outran fellow Horizon League squad Green Bay.  Grand Valley State captured the team championship with 45 points, while Windsor’s Matt Walters turned in a time of 24:54 to take top individual honors.

The Crusaders were paced on Friday by senior Nick Fagan (Sycamore, Ill./Sycamore), who placed 106th with a time of 27:05.  Junior Wally Bradford (Mukwonago, Wis./Mukwonago) followed close behind Fagan, covering the circuit in 27:13, good for a 110th place finish.

Freshman Eric Hickok (Schererville, Ind./Lake Central) was the next Valpo runner across the line, finishing in 132nd place with a time of 27:48.  The Crusaders’ last two scoring runners crossed the line back-to-back, as senior Jordan Piaskowy (Crete, Ill./Illiana Christian) ran a time of 28:04 to finish 137th and sophomore Kiefer Heiman (Nashville, Ill./Nashville) followed right behind Piaskowy in 138th, posting a time of 28:13.

Valparaiso returns to action in two weekends, making the trip downstate to run at the Evansville Invitational on Saturday, Oct. 15.  Action on the 15th is slated for a 10 a.m. CDT start.
